Can you tell me what renting a home is like in the U.S.A?

Asked by LornaLove (10037points) November 24th, 2016

I’m in the U.K.

This is my first home that I rented in the U.K. and I have been here now, 3 years and a bit. I rented through a rental management company.
I’m not really used to renting since I always owned my own home.

Anyway, I thought I’d share some of the intricacies involved in renting, to see how we compare?

We pay a full deposit. I had to pay in cash, wish was a bit odd I felt.
If you want an animal, meaning any sort of a pet you have to pay double deposit.

Every three months we are visited by the company who checks the home. I find this quite irritating. They also tell you that they could arrive anytime between say 9 am and 5am. Surely by now they know I am an Okay tenant since I’ve been here 3 plus years? I find that the most annoying part!

We are responsible for decorating the house. Painting the walls, fixing things in general and also, of course, tending the garden. As well as ensuring there are light bulbs in all the outlets at all times.

So far, are we similar? How do we compare?
